Corporal Foster was a veteran of World War II. In Korea, he was a member of Company L, 3rd Battalion, 5th Infantry Regimental Combat Team. He was Killed in Action while fighting the enemy near Kogan-ni, South Korea, on 9 August 1950.
Foster was awarded the Purple Heart, the Combat Infantryman's Badge, the Korean Service Medal, the United Nations Service Medal, the National Defense Service Medal, the Korean Presidential Unit Citation, the Republic of Korea War Service Medal and the World War II Victory Medal.
